WebJul 14, 2024 · Bolivian rams and angelfish thrive in similar water conditions. Bolivian rams and angelfish are freshwater fish that originate from South America. They can thrive in soft to acidic water, at a ph of 6.0-7.5. Angelfish thrives at aquarium water temperatures between 78°F and 84°F, while Bolivian rams require a temperature of 72°F and 79°F. WebMar 3, 2015 · Care Level: Hard. Water Conditions: 6.5 – 7.5 pH and Soft. Temperature: 71-81 °F (22-27 °C) Maximum Size: 3 inches (8 cm) Bolivian rams (Mikrogeophagus altispinosus), or Bolivian butterflys, are a small, … WebFor a cichlid, the Bolivian Ram is quite a small fish. The males can grow to a length of 3.5 inches (9 cm), but are most likely to be around 3 inches (8 cm). The females are smaller …
